๐Ÿ›๏ธ Can My Pillow Cause Neck Pain?

Do you regularly wake up with a stiff, sore, or difficult-to-move neck? Your pillow could be one contributing factor.

A pillowโ€™s main purpose is to support your head and help keep your neck aligned with the rest of your spine. If your pillow is too high, too low, too firm, or too soft for your sleeping position, your neck may remain bent or twisted for several hours. This may strain the surrounding muscles and joints, leading to morning discomfort.

Signs your pillow may not be supporting your neck properly include:

๐Ÿ”น Neck stiffness after waking up
๐Ÿ”น Pain that improves after you begin moving
๐Ÿ”น Tightness across the neck and shoulders
๐Ÿ”น Difficulty turning your head in the morning
๐Ÿ”น Headaches that begin near the base of the skull
๐Ÿ”น Frequently folding or stacking your pillow for support

Your ideal pillow depends partly on how you sleep:

โœ… Side Sleepers: Choose a pillow that fills the space between your shoulder and head without tilting your neck upward or downward.

โœ… Back Sleepers: Use a pillow that supports the natural curve of your neck without pushing your head too far forward.

โœ… Stomach Sleepers: This position may keep the neck rotated for long periods. A thinner pillow may reduce strain, but changing your sleep position could also help.

There is no single pillow that works for everyone. Body size, shoulder width, mattress firmness, existing spinal conditions, and sleep position can all affect the amount of support you need.

A new pillow may help when poor support is contributing to the problem, but persistent neck pain should not automatically be blamed on your pillow. Arthritis, muscle strain, a pinched nerve, disc problems, an injury, or another medical condition may also cause neck pain.

Contact a healthcare professional if your pain is severe, continues for several days, spreads into your shoulder or arm, or occurs with numbness, tingling, or weakness.

Does Poor Posture Cause Chronic Back Pain?

Poor posture may not be the only cause of chronic back pain, but it can contribute to discomfortโ€”especially when you remain in the same position for long periods.

Slouching at a desk, leaning forward toward a screen, or sitting without proper lower-back support may place additional strain on the muscles, ligaments, and joints that support your spine. Over time, these habits may contribute to:

๐Ÿ”น Muscle tension and fatigue
๐Ÿ”น Lower-back stiffness
๐Ÿ”น Reduced spinal mobility
๐Ÿ”น Pain after prolonged sitting
๐Ÿ”น Neck and shoulder discomfort
๐Ÿ”น Increased discomfort during daily activities

Small changes to your workspace and routine may help reduce unnecessary strain:

โœ… Keep both feet flat on the floor
โœ… Support the natural curve of your lower back
โœ… Position your screen close to eye level
โœ… Keep your shoulders relaxed
โœ… Avoid remaining in one position for too long
โœ… Take regular movement and stretching breaks
โœ… Use a chair that provides proper support

Remember, there is no single โ€œperfectโ€ posture that must be maintained all day. Changing positions, staying active, and using a comfortable workstation are also important.

If your back pain continues, becomes severe, travels into your legs, or is accompanied by numbness or weakness, it may be time for a professional evaluation. An accurate diagnosis can help determine whether your symptoms are related to muscle strain, nerve irritation, disc problems, arthritis, or another condition.

๐Ÿง  Racing Thoughts: Common Signs and Triggers

Does your mind keep jumping from one thought to anotherโ€”even when you are trying to relax or sleep?

Racing thoughts can feel like several ideas, worries, memories, and โ€œwhat ifโ€ questions arriving all at once. You may feel mentally exhausted, yet unable to slow your mind down.

Common signs may include:

๐Ÿ”น Thoughts that move quickly or feel difficult to control
๐Ÿ”น Trouble concentrating on one task or conversation
๐Ÿ”น Replaying past situations repeatedly
๐Ÿ”น Constantly anticipating possible problems
๐Ÿ”น Difficulty relaxing or falling asleep
๐Ÿ”น Feeling restless, tense, overwhelmed, or irritable

Possible triggers may include:

โšก Ongoing stress or emotional pressure
โšก Anxiety and excessive worrying
โšก Lack of sleep or an irregular sleep routine
โšก Major life changes or relationship concerns
โšก Work, financial, family, or health-related worries
โšก Too much caffeine or other stimulants

Racing thoughts are not a diagnosis by themselves. However, if they occur frequently, affect your sleep, interrupt your daily routine, or make it difficult to focus, speaking with a qualified mental-health professional may help identify what is contributing to them.

Try pausing, taking slow breaths, reducing stimulation, writing down your thoughts, and maintaining a regular sleep schedule. Most importantly, remember that you do not have to manage an overwhelmed mind alone.

Why Does My Lower Back Hurt When I Wake Up?

Waking up with lower back pain can be more than just an uncomfortable start to your morning. If you regularly experience stiffness, soreness, or aching in your lower back after waking up, it may be a sign that something needs attention.

There can be several reasons behind morning lower back pain. Your sleeping position can put unnecessary pressure on your spine, while staying in one position for several hours may cause muscles and joints to become stiff. Muscle or joint strain, poor posture, physical activity, and certain spinal conditions can also contribute to recurring discomfort.

Sometimes, the pain may improve after you get up and start moving. However, if the discomfort keeps coming back, lasts throughout the day, becomes more intense, or starts affecting your normal activities, itโ€™s important not to simply ignore it.

๐ŸŒ™ DOES LACK OF SLEEP AFFECT YOUR MENTAL HEALTH?

The answer is yes. Sleep is not only about physical restโ€”it also helps your brain regulate emotions, process information, manage stress, and maintain focus.

When you consistently do not get enough quality sleep, you may experience:

๐Ÿ”น Mood Changes: You may feel more irritable, frustrated, emotional, or overwhelmed.

๐Ÿ”น Increased Anxiety: Poor sleep may make everyday stress feel harder to manage and may worsen anxious thoughts.

๐Ÿ”น Poor Focus: Sleep loss can affect concentration, memory, decision-making, and productivity.

๐Ÿ”น Low Energy: Ongoing tiredness may reduce your motivation and make normal daily responsibilities feel exhausting.

๐Ÿ”น Emotional Distress: Frequent sleep difficulties may be associated with increased mental distress and depressive symptoms.

One restless night does not necessarily indicate a mental health condition. However, if you regularly struggle to fall asleep, wake up frequently, feel exhausted during the day, or notice changes in your mood and behavior, it may be time to seek professional support.

A consistent sleep schedule, a relaxing bedtime routine, reduced screen time before bed, and limiting late-day caffeine may help. If the problem continues, speak with a qualified healthcare professional.

Is It Arthritis or Normal Aging? ๐Ÿค”

Many people assume that joint pain, stiffness, or difficulty moving is simply part of getting older. But when pain starts interfering with your daily routine, it may be time to look deeper.

Arthritis can affect the hands, knees, hips, shoulders, spine, and other joints. Symptoms may develop gradually and can make even simple activities feel difficultโ€”such as walking, climbing stairs, getting dressed, opening a bottle, or sleeping comfortably.

Watch for common signs like:

โœ… Morning stiffness that does not go away quickly
โœ… Joint swelling, tenderness, or warmth
โœ… Pain during walking, bending, gripping, or climbing stairs
โœ… Reduced range of motion or flexibility
โœ… Recurring pain that affects work, sleep, or daily activities

Depression is more than simply feeling sad for a day or two.

It can affect how you think, sleep, work, connect with others, and handle everyday life. Many people try to push through quietly, but emotional health deserves the same care and attention as physical health.

Some common signs of depression may include:

โ€ข Persistent sadness, emptiness, or hopelessness
โ€ข Losing interest in activities you once enjoyed
โ€ข Changes in sleep or appetite
โ€ข Low energy or feeling tired most of the time
โ€ข Difficulty concentrating or making decisions
โ€ข Feeling withdrawn, irritable, or overwhelmed
โ€ข Feelings of guilt, worthlessness, or isolation

Having one of these signs does not automatically mean someone has depression. However, if these feelings continue, affect daily life, or feel difficult to manage, reaching out for professional support can be an important next step.

What is Spinal Cord Stimulation?
Spinal cord stimulation is an advanced pain-management treatment that uses carefully controlled electrical stimulation to influence pain signals before they reach the brain.

โœ… Targets chronic pain
Designed for certain types of persistent nerve and spine-related pain.

โœ… Adjustable stimulation
Stimulation settings can be personalized and adjusted based on your needs and treatment response.

โœ… Minimally invasive approach
SCS is delivered through an implanted system using specialized leads and a small pulse generator.

โœ… May help improve daily life
For appropriate patients, reducing pain may help support greater comfort, mobility, and participation in everyday activities.

ANXIETY MAY BE AFFECTING MORE THAN YOUR THOUGHTS ๐Ÿ’›

Anxiety can influence your sleep, concentration, relationships, physical comfort, and ability to manage everyday responsibilities. When it becomes frequent, even familiar parts of your routine may feel difficult or overwhelming.

Five possible signs to notice:

๐ŸŒ™ SLEEP CHANGES
Difficulty falling asleep, waking frequently, or feeling mentally alert when your body is tired.

๐Ÿ“‹ AVOIDING DAILY TASKS
Calls, appointments, errands, emails, or household responsibilities may begin to feel overwhelming.

๐Ÿง  TROUBLE FOCUSING
Anxious thoughts may make it harder to concentrate, make decisions, remember information, or complete tasks.

โšก PHYSICAL TENSION
Anxiety may appear as tight muscles, headaches, restlessness, an uneasy stomach, or a racing heartbeat.

๐Ÿ‘ฅ WITHDRAWING FROM OTHERS
You may cancel plans or distance yourself from friends and family because social interaction feels exhausting.

Experiencing these signs occasionally does not automatically indicate an anxiety disorder. Stress, sleep issues, physical conditions, medications, and other factors can cause similar changes.

However, if these experiences regularly interfere with your work, sleep, relationships, or daily life, consider speaking with a qualified mental-health professional.

Persistent pain around the lower back, buttock, hip, or pelvis can make everyday movement feel difficult. If your discomfort is linked to the sacroiliac (SI) joint, an SI Joint Injection may help identify the source of pain and provide targeted relief.

The SI joints connect the base of the spine to the pelvis. When these joints become irritated or inflamed, pain may travel into the buttocks, hips, groin, or upper legs. Sitting, standing, climbing stairs, turning in bed, and getting up from a chair can all become uncomfortable.

An SI Joint Injection is a minimally invasive procedure in which medication is placed directly near the affected SI joint. Your provider may use imaging guidance, such as ultrasound or X-ray, to help position the injection precisely.

This treatment may help patients with:

* Lower Back Pain That Persists Despite Rest
* Pain On One Side Of The Buttock Or Pelvis
* Hip Or Groin Discomfort
* Pain That Worsens With Standing, Walking, Or Stairs
* Suspected SI Joint Inflammation Or Dysfunction

Every patientโ€™s pain is different. A consultation and proper evaluation can help determine whether an SI Joint Injection is an appropriate option for your condition.
